Abstract :
Through sedimentologic and petroleum geologic analysis of over 300 exploration wells in the north part of the west slope in the Songliao Basin, the conduit role the incised valley played in the oil and gas accumulation of the Fulaerji oil field is investigated. The major pays in the Fulaerji oil and gas field are the second and third members of the Cretaceous Yaojia Formation, where the hydrocarbon comes primarily from the Qijia-Gulong sag about 80 km east. The pathway of long distance hydrocarbon migration is the overlapping sandstone complex which fills the incised valley. The incised valley deposits overlapped on the delta deposits toward basin, and connected with shore-shallow lake sandy beach-bar formed during the highest lake flooding period toward the basin margin, constituting a sand rich sedimentary complex of delta - incised valley filling - shore sandy beach bar. Towards the basin, delta sand branches and pinches out in mudstone (mature source rock), transporting the hydrocarbon generated in the effective hydrocarbon kitchen to the incised valley filling body, the incised valley filling deposits transported hydrocarbon for a long distance to the updip pinching sandy beach bar lithologic trap, giving birth to the Fulaerji oil and gas reservoir. In the sand-rich sedimentary system related to the incised valley filling, the effective hydrocarbon transporting system is limited along Well Du 412 - Du 71 - Du 65 - Jiang 39 - Jiang 41 and Fulaerji oil and gas field. The pure hydrocarbon transporting layer is a water production layer with a high degree of hydrocarbon impregnation and low residual oil saturation. Baiyinnuole, Erzhan, Alaxin, Jiangqiao oil and gas fields distributed like a string of beads in NW are closely related to this effective hydrocarbon transporting system.
